Course details


Smart Contract Security: This unit focuses on the security aspects of smart contracts, which are a crucial component of blockchain-based health apps. It covers the risks associated with smart contracts, such as reentrancy attacks and front-running attacks, and provides guidance on how to write secure smart contracts. •
Cryptographic Techniques for Data Protection: This unit explores the use of advanced cryptographic techniques, such as homomorphic encryption and zero-knowledge proofs, to protect sensitive health data on blockchain networks. It also covers the use of secure multi-party computation protocols to enable secure data sharing. •
Blockchain Security Architecture: This unit provides an overview of the security architecture of blockchain networks, including the role of nodes, miners, and consensus algorithms. It also covers the use of security protocols, such as secure boot and secure enclaves, to protect the integrity of the blockchain. •
Identity and Access Management for Blockchain Health Apps: This unit focuses on the importance of identity and access management (IAM) in blockchain-based health apps. It covers the use of digital identity solutions, such as self-sovereign identity and decentralized identity management, to enable secure access to health data. •
Blockchain Security for Interoperability: This unit explores the challenges of interoperability in blockchain-based health apps and provides guidance on how to ensure secure data exchange between different blockchain networks. It covers the use of standards-based solutions, such as Hyperledger Fabric and Corda, to enable secure interoperability. •
Threat Modeling and Risk Assessment for Blockchain Health Apps: This unit provides a framework for threat modeling and risk assessment in blockchain-based health apps. It covers the use of threat modeling techniques, such as attack trees and threat diagrams, to identify potential security risks and prioritize mitigation efforts. •
Blockchain Security for Supply Chain Management: This unit focuses on the use of blockchain technology to secure supply chain management in the healthcare industry. It covers the use of blockchain-based solutions, such as smart contracts and inventory management systems, to track the origin and movement of medical supplies. •
Blockchain Security for Electronic Health Records: This unit explores the use of blockchain technology to secure electronic health records (EHRs) in the healthcare industry. It covers the use of blockchain-based solutions, such as decentralized EHR systems and secure data storage, to protect sensitive health information. •
Blockchain Security for Telemedicine: This unit focuses on the use of blockchain technology to secure telemedicine services in the healthcare industry. It covers the use of blockchain-based solutions, such as secure video conferencing systems and encrypted data storage, to protect patient data and ensure secure communication. •
Blockchain Security for Regulatory Compliance: This unit provides guidance on how to ensure regulatory compliance with blockchain-based health apps. It covers the use of blockchain-based solutions, such as audit trails and compliance reporting, to demonstrate regulatory compliance and ensure the integrity of the blockchain.

Career path

Blockchain Security Career Roles in the UK: Primary Keywords: Blockchain Security, Health Apps, UK Job Market 1. Blockchain Security Specialist: A Blockchain Security Specialist is responsible for ensuring the security and integrity of blockchain-based systems, particularly in the healthcare industry. They design and implement secure blockchain architectures, conduct vulnerability assessments, and develop incident response plans. 2. Health App Security Consultant: A Health App Security Consultant works with healthcare organizations to assess and improve the security of their mobile apps. They identify vulnerabilities, develop secure coding practices, and provide guidance on compliance with regulatory requirements. 3. Cybersecurity Analyst (Healthcare): A Cybersecurity Analyst (Healthcare) monitors and analyzes the security of healthcare organizations' networks and systems. They identify potential threats, develop incident response plans, and collaborate with other teams to ensure the security of sensitive patient data. 4. Data Analytics Specialist (Blockchain): A Data Analytics Specialist (Blockchain) analyzes and interprets data from blockchain-based systems to identify trends and patterns. They develop predictive models, create data visualizations, and provide insights to stakeholders. 5. Cloud Security Engineer (Healthcare): A Cloud Security Engineer (Healthcare) designs and implements secure cloud-based systems for healthcare organizations. They ensure compliance with regulatory requirements, develop secure access controls, and monitor cloud-based systems for security threats.
